South Yarra Auto Parts (NSW)

Landline: 02 9669 6933

South Yarra Auto Parts (NSW)
Category: Automotive Services

Key contact details for South Yarra Auto Parts (NSW)
Landline
02 9669 6933
Address
41 Birmingham St, Alexandria, New South Wales 2015

0 Customer reviews
Write a review

Quick links